SQL Server 2000 启动服务管理器出现问题的常见原因与解决方案 数据库无法启动的应对技巧

13864 次阅读

SQL Server 2000服务管理器启动失败的原因有哪些

哈喽,遇到SQL Server 2000服务管理器启动失败是不是特别崩溃啊?通常情况下,这问题最常见的原因有几种:

  1. 服务器启动账户出错:有时候启动SQL Server的账户权限不对,就会启动不了。尤其是如果账户没权限访问数据库文件或者系统资源,很可能就直接“啪”的停了服务。
  2. 数据库系统文件损坏:像tempdb不能打开基本上是数据库文件损坏或者丢失导致的。你看日志里报“未能打开tempdb无法继续”,这就是典型信号。
  3. 系统时间设置混乱:奇怪的是,很多朋友时间没调好,SQL Server也启动不了。时间差距比较大时,认证失败也是常见原因。
  4. 网络配置问题:有些情况下,SQL Server的网络协议设置会影响服务启动,特别是禁用或错误设置了VIA协议。
  5. 权限不足或登录失败:账号身份验证模式设置错误或者账户没有管理员权限,也会造成服务启动失败情况。

总之,别着急,我们接下来帮你一步步理清楚怎么解决。

sql 2000数据库无法启动

SQL Server 2000无法启动时怎么一步步修复和排查

那问题来了,面对SQL Server 2000启动失败,我们该从哪儿开始动手呢?来,咱们聊聊几个实用的步骤,照着做,一般都能奏效:

  1. 确认启动账户和密码
    先跑到“控制面板 -> 管理工具 -> 服务”,找到SQL Server对应的服务,右键属性,确认启动账户是正确的。
    - 如果之前用的是某个域账号,试试改成本地系统账户(Local System Account)。
    - 密码改了,没更新服务设置,也会启动失败哦。

  2. 调整系统时间
    Windows任务栏右下角点时间,设置日期时间,调回一两周前的时间,保存后再试启动。
    这招有时神奇得很,竟然就靠谱了。

  3. 数据库损坏时的备份和修复
    - 重要!先备份所有数据库文件(数据文件和日志都别忘了),以防万一。
    - 卸载当前SQL Server 2000,选择完全卸载,干净利落。
    - 重新安装SQL Server 2000,顺便补上SP4补丁,这一步相当关键。
    - 如果是master数据库损坏,可以用单用户模式启动,尝试修复或者恢复事务日志。

  4. 禁用不必要的网络协议
    使用配置管理器,找到SQL Server的网络协议设置,禁用VIA协议,尤其是Windows 7出现服务自动停止的情况,这个操作可能奏效。

  5. 登录失败或权限问题处理
    - 改认证模式后别忘重启服务!
    - 需要保证SQL Server服务账户有管理员权限,要不然运行企业管理器的时候,有的操作就报错。

  6. 查看系统日志获取更多线索
    出问题时,别忘翻翻系统事件查看器,看看SQL Server启动相关的错误代码和描述,这可是定位问题的利器。

说实话,这些步骤看起来挺多,但其实一步步做下来,99%都能把SQL Server 2000给“复活”起来。不用怕,我们慢慢来,稳扎稳打就没问题啦!

sql 2000数据库无法启动

相关问题解答

  1. 为什么我修改了SQL Server启动账户,服务还是启动不了呢?
    哎呀,这个咋说呢,最有可能是新账户的密码你没更新到服务里,或者权限不够。试试看把服务账户改回原来的,或者用本地系统账户,保证密码对了,权限够,就容易启动。别忘了修改后要重启服务和计算机哦,有时候就是靠这些小细节搞定的。

  2. 系统时间调整真的能影响SQL Server启动吗?
    天呐,居然真的管用!尤其是时间差距太大,SQL Server会因为身份验证不对,拒绝启动。把时间往回调一周左右、保存关闭,然后再启动服务,很多小伙伴都说“哇,居然成功了!”真的是因小失大的细节,超值得一试。

  3. 数据库文件损坏了,备份和修复要注意些什么?
    嗯,这事儿得特别小心哈,备份是王道,大家一定一定别着急修复之前忘了备份!备份好文件后,可以考虑卸载重装或用修复工具修复数据库文件。如果是master数据库坏了,那更要启动单用户模式,慎重操作,避免数据丢失,大家慢慢来,拎清步骤很关键!

  4. 服务启动失败时,日志可以帮忙排查多大程度的问题?
    日志就是我们的救命稻草啊,严重建议大家赶紧打开系统事件查看器和SQL Server错误日志,好多问题没看日志根本懵。日志里通常会提醒比如哪个文件打不开、哪个权限不足,或者网络协议报错,基本把问题细节都写得明明白白,仔细看,你会找到解决办法的线索,超级重要!

发布评论

穆瑞 2025-11-14
我发布了文章《SQL Server 2000 启动服务管理器出现问题的常见原因与解决方案 数据库无法启动的应对技巧》,希望对大家有用!欢迎在游戏普及中查看更多精彩内容。
用户110639 1小时前
关于《SQL Server 2000 启动服务管理器出现问题的常见原因与解决方案 数据库无法启动的应对技巧》这篇文章,穆瑞的写作风格很清晰,特别是内容分析这部分,学到了很多新知识!
用户110640 1天前
在游戏普及看到这篇2025-11-14发布的文章,卡片式布局很美观,内容组织得井井有条,特别是作者穆瑞的排版,阅读体验非常好!